Wiki — Break-glass access, Monthvault partitioning service. Monthvault partitions the ledger tables by calendar month; repartitioning jobs run on the first of each month and hold exclusive locks. If a job wedges and normal credentials fail, break-glass access is permitted for reviewers. Authenticate at the maintenance prompt using the passphrase below.

vault phrase of tajef-tafog = istox-sorax-zorox-casok-holox-kelix-weneth-drueth-casion

## Changelog — DeployDrake 3.2.0: Changed defaults

DeployDrake, our chat bot for deploy status, now posts summaries to a single channel per environment instead of per service, and the polling interval has doubled to reduce noise during busy release windows. Support should expect fewer but denser messages; nothing about alert severity changed. If a customer asks why updates look different, point them to this entry. The new default configuration shipped with 3.2.0 is:

deployment values, yafop-tahof:
HOLIX_HOST=holix.zemvarsys.internal
HOLIX_PORT=3306

Handover: SproutCycle Scheduler

I'm passing SproutCycle over ahead of the weekly sync. The watering scheduler now reads soil-moisture thresholds from the Fernworth config service, and the midnight skip bug is fixed but needs a week of observation. Greenhouse Bay 3 still runs the legacy timer — migrate it last. Ongoing monitoring and the remaining migration are now the responsibility of the engineer named below.

named custodian: Brivan Eliath Quenox Frador